Düsseldorf vs Paris Cost of Living
Düsseldorf (Germany) · Overall index 56.6 — Paris (France) · Overall index 68.3
Summary
- Overall, Paris is 21% more expensive than Düsseldorf.
- Rent in Paris is 43% more expensive than in Düsseldorf.
- Dining out in Paris is 22% more expensive than in Düsseldorf.
